Real-World Examples of AI Washing: Lessons from Overhyped Claims

Image
In today’s hyper-competitive tech landscape, nearly every company wants to be seen as an innovator by touting “AI-powered” solutions. Yet, behind this buzz often lies AI washing—the practice of exaggerating or misrepresenting AI capabilities to attract attention, investment, or customers. While genuine AI breakthroughs are transforming industries, many overhyped claims have led to disillusionment, damaged reputations, and even legal headaches. Let’s dive into some real-world examples of AI washing that highlight the risks of trading authenticity for buzz. One of the most talked-about cases is IBM Watson Health. Once hailed as a revolutionary AI solution set to transform healthcare, Watson Health was promoted as an intelligent system capable of diagnosing diseases and recommending treatment options with unprecedented accuracy. Scaling AI? Here’s Why Federated Learning is Your Best Bet

Image
Building AI models is great—until you hit scalability issues. Traditional machine learning models depend on centralized servers that require vast amounts of storage and computing power. Federated Learning (FL) eliminates this problem by allowing AI training across multiple devices, making AI faster, scalable, and more efficient. Benefits of FL include: 🚀 Parallel training on multiple datasets —reducing time-to-market. 📊 Lower cloud costs —minimizing expensive data transfers. 🔒 Improved security —keeping raw data on user devices. Think about smartphones using AI-powered voice assistants —each device learns independently but contributes to a global model without ever sharing user recordings . This not only accelerates AI learning but also makes it cost-effective and resource-efficient . For businesses struggling with data silos and scaling issues , FL offers a breakthrough solution. But with the introduction of  Artificial Intelligence  (AI) for Edge Computing will clear most of these queries satisfactorily. What is Edge Computing ? A Computing paradigm where most computing or in some cases total computing is performed on smart devices or edge devices instead of the centralized cloud is known as Edge Computing. Edge Computing is considered as the first stage of Intent of Things; It handles the responsibility of collecting the data. Since the data collection takes place on the end-to-end devices; unlike the existing centralized cloud computing in data centres; the data privacy and the data security aspects have come to the forefront.
